HIP 30257
HIP 30257 is a A-type (White) star.
At a distance of roughly 1,469 light-years, HIP 30257 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 30257 is classified as a spectral class A star (A-type (White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 30257 has an apparent magnitude of +8.52,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its blue h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of -0.009.
